    Job Summary

    Under limited supervision, the Operations Specialist Lead, Borrower and Loan Services, serves as a subject matter expert for the FFEL loan program and guarantor duties.  This role is the primary contact for internal and external parties for assigned areas of expertise. Provides front line support to the borrower and loan services team to address customer loan and processing questions.

    Essential Duties and Responsibilities

    • Leads and supports complex projects such as system enhancements and loan portfolio conversions, data validation and issue resolution.
    • Maintains portfolio integrity by overseeing loan maintenance activities and resolving complex loan data scenarios with a high level of autonomy.
    • Conducts in-depth research and analysis of complex loan issues, providing timely and accurate responses to internal and external stakeholders.
    • Performs quality assurance reviews on processed work, provides feedback to team members and maintains detailed QA records to support continuous improvement.
    • Maintains confidentiality of information regarding individual team member performance.
    • Trains new hires and existing staff in customer service functions and handles escalated customer inquiries to ensure high service standards.
    • Prepares and manages departmental reports and procedures, responds to audit requests, and stays current on FFEL program knowledge and downstream process impacts.
    • Performs other duties and responsibilities as assigned.

    ECMC Group also provides a comprehensive benefits package:  

    • Health & wellness benefits: Medical, dental, and vision insurance plan options, with a generous employer subsidy. Company paid life & disability insurance, pre-tax flexible spending accounts and robust wellness programs.
    • Financial benefits: Generous 401(k) plan with a company match up to 6% and additional discretionary contribution potential, holiday time off, paid time off accrual starting at 20 days/year and commuter subsidy.
    • Education benefits: Tuition reimbursement up to $10,500/year for approved programs and student loan payment reimbursement up to $4,800/year. Up to $5,250 of qualifying education benefits can be reimbursed pre-tax.
